Do you have any good methods for getting Space Marine shoulder pads off of the arms without damaging them too much?

I usually run my knife around the edges and try to prise them off, but that sometimes bends them a bit, and occasionally doesn't do any good at all.

Any suggestions are much appreciated.

A good pair of tweezers and some leverage. But I only put a small amount of superglue on the pads when I assemble so it's not as if I'm trying to break plastic glue. Never go for the edge because that will snap it right in half. Just slowly get some bite under the pad, pinch it and lift. Shape of the tweezers shouldn't damage the surface but I do get some edge nicks trying to get the bottom bit under the lip of the pad.
